Course Content

This amazing full-time Foundation Diploma is broken down into three key stages. In the Exploratory Stage, you’ll take part in creative skills workshops and challenges, attend artist talks, galleries, and artwork made on location. The Pathways Stage will see you explore specialist project briefs and critical reviews, whilst providing you with portfolio support and UCAS guidance. You’ll also have the opportunity for a residential in Amsterdam. The last stage is your Final Major Project which results in a public exhibition of your work. You’re free to research what kind of creative future you wish to pursue and learn how to operate as a professional artist or designer. This helps ensure you have a pathway to a rewarding career in your chosen field.
